Sean Penn attached to produce, possibly star in surfing biopic

Filed under: Movies, News and tagged: ,

Variety is reporting that Sean Penn is attached to produce and possibly star in a biopic about surfing legend Dorian “Doc” Paskowitz, who famously abandoned a medical practice and traveled along American beaches with his wife, eight sons, and one daughter in a 24-foot RV. (The Paskowitz clan was also the subject of the 2008 documentary Surfwise.) Alan and Gabe Polsky (Bad Lieutenant: Port of Call New Orleans) are also producing, and producer Paul Feldsher (The Four Feathers) is attached to write the script.

In the same story, Variety also mentioned that Penn is interested in joining director Curtis Hanson’s soon-to-shoot surfing movie Mavericks in a supporting role.
